COTABATO CITY: Amid the clashes in some parts of the region, the Autonomous Region in Muslim Mindanao (ARMM) is showcasing its grandest mock tribal villages narrating the variety of cultures, traditions, history and oneness of the Bangsamoro people.

The exhibit that runs until December 2018, focuses on celebrating the diversity of cultures in the region’s five component provinces of Sulu, Basilan, Tawi-Tawi, Lanao del Sur and Maguindanao. It will form part of the 29th founding anniversary of the ARMM and held at the compound of the regional governor’s office here.
